Hey, I found the answer:
When Silence Is Broken, The Night Is Torn is the debut EP by the metalcore band Eyes Set to Kill. This was the only album to feature Lindsey Vogt as lead vocalist and Alex Torres as the second guitarist.[1] Three songs from the album ("Liar In The Glass", "Darling", "Young Blood Spills Tonight") were re-recorded for their debut album, Reach following her departure in 2007.
